Mule SFTP:如何在远程位置创建目录

Mule SFTP:如何在远程位置创建目录,mule,sftp,mule-studio,Mule,Sftp,Mule Studio,我正在尝试使用mule通过SFTP发送文件。我们必须为此指定一个固定路径,比如/home/ftp/然后在outputpattern中指定文件名。但我想在远程位置动态创建目录。每次发送文件时,都应将其发送到新目录中 比如abc.txt:/home/ftp/abc/abc.txt pqr.txt:/home/ftp/pqw/pqr.txt我想说,您需要一个自定义java组件来创建此文件夹 我通过在MULE中重写FtpMessageDispatcher实现了这一点 好吧,我就是这么想的。是否可以更改现

我正在尝试使用mule通过SFTP发送文件。我们必须为此指定一个固定路径,比如/home/ftp/然后在outputpattern中指定文件名。但我想在远程位置动态创建目录。每次发送文件时,都应将其发送到新目录中

比如abc.txt:/home/ftp/abc/abc.txt


pqr.txt:/home/ftp/pqw/pqr.txt

我想说,您需要一个自定义java组件来创建此文件夹


我通过在MULE中重写
FtpMessageDispatcher
实现了这一点

好吧,我就是这么想的。是否可以更改现有的sftp连接器实现?这样我的流代码就不会被修改了?